Sažetak
A fundamental property of biological membrane is to act as a barrierto permation of polar molecules. This barrier effect is largely due to a hydrophobicity of a phospholipid bilayer, determined by the extent of water penetration into the nmembrane. In order to study the depth of water penetration into liposomes, we used the electron spin resonance method (1), that takes advantage of the solvent effect on the hyperfine interaction of the nitroxide spin labels. A fatty acids with the paramagnetic nitroxide group of the spin label covalently attached at the various positions along the fatty acid chain was introduced into multilamellar liposomes. The hydrophobic barrier for water molecules, as well as, for small molecules such as glycine, was studied as a function of the liposome composition and size.
